Proposal Coordinator
- Prometheus Federal Services (Fairfax, VA)
-
Position Summary
Prometheus Federal Services (PFS) is a trusted partner of federal health agencies. We are seeking a dynamic Proposal Coordinator to assist Senior Management in growing the company. The Proposal Coordinator will support the proposal development lifecycle for federal government pursuits, with a primary focus on the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). Responsibilities include creating and administering proposal processes, ensuring compliance, providing guidance to authors, and preparing related reports. Tasks include RFP Analysis, Kick-Off Meetings, Status Calls, Proposal Development, Writing, Reviews, and Production. The role also involves assisting with responses to Requests for Information and other marketing assignments.
Additionally, the Proposal Coordinator will support the Growth Team in broader business development activities, including managing day-to-day contract vehicle Project Management Office (PMO) activities, partner management, database management, survey development, research, and maintaining templates, tools, and processes. This role is critical in developing compliant, compelling, and winning proposals, leveraging a thorough understanding of the entire proposal process from pre-RFP through customer award debriefs.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
+ Manage the full life cycle of RFP analysis, response development, writing, and submission.
+ Write and manage the technical proposal sections, RFI responses, white papers, resumes, past performance citations, or other proposal narratives in response to solicitations.
+ Interpret RFP requirements for compliance mapping.
+ Develop proposal templates, outlines, compliance matrices, resource alignments, and related checklists.
+ Develop and manage the proposal schedule and report on progress.
+ Research, organize, and document solutions and content.
+ Research, collect, and develop reusable material for individual authors.
+ Edit and format documents and manage proposal development and production.
+ Coordinate, prepare for, participate in, and document (e.g., notes, action items) proposal meetings and reviews.
+ Ensure submissions are accurate, complete, and compliant with RFP requirements and editorial specifications, as well as corporate quality and branding standards.
+ Support in maintaining business development reference materials (e.g., past performance, resumes, proposal content, graphics).
+ Support in the day-to-day PMO activities, including partner management, database management, and survey development.
